Purpose: Defines an interface for circular buffers. Data can be written to
and read from these buffers as though from a file. When it is
write-overflowed (you write more data in than the buffer can hold),
the read pointer is advanced to allow the new data to be written.
This means old data will be discarded if you write too much data
into the buffer.

#ifndef CIRCULARBUFFER_H
#define CIRCULARBUFFER_H
#pragma once
class CCircularBuffer
{
protected:
CCircularBuffer(int size);
void SetSize(int nSize);
void AssertValid();
public:
void Flush();
int GetSize(); // Get the size of the buffer (how much can you write without reading
// before losing data.
int GetWriteAvailable(); // Get the amount available to write without overflowing.
// Note: you can write however much you want, but it may overflow,
// in which case the newest data is kept and the oldest is discarded.
int GetReadAvailable(); // Get the amount available to read.
int GetMaxUsed();
int Peek(char *pchDest, int nCount);
int Advance(int nCount);
int Read(void *pchDest, int nCount);
int Write(void *pchData, int nCount);
public:
int m_nCount; // Space between the read and write pointers (how much data we can read).
int m_nRead; // Read index into circular buffer
int m_nWrite; // Write index into circular buffer
int m_nSize; // Size of circular buffer in bytes (how much data it can hold).
char m_chData[1]; // Circular buffer holding data
};
// Use this to instantiate a CircularBuffer.
template<int size>
class CSizedCircularBuffer : public CCircularBuffer
{
public:
CSizedCircularBuffer() :
CCircularBuffer(size)
{
}
private:
char myData[size-1];
};
#endif // CIRCULARBUFFER_H
